Praline Drink
🛠 Equipment
- Saucepan
- Whisk
- Mug or glass
- Immersion blender
🛒 Ingredients
| 500 ml | Whole milk | |
| 4 tbsp | Praline paste | |
| 100 ml | Heavy cream | |
| 1 packet | Vanilla sugar | |
| 4 | Speculoos cookies | |
| optional | Whipped cream (for topping) |
Preparation
Step 1
Pour the whole milk into a saucepan and heat gently without boiling. Add the praline paste and vanilla sugar, then whisk vigorously until the paste is completely dissolved in the milk. The drink should be perfectly smooth and lightly colored. Let it simmer gently for 2 minutes.
Step 2
Remove from heat and stir in the heavy cream with a whisk to achieve a creamy, velvety texture. If you have an immersion blender, give it a quick blend to make the drink even frothier and airier. Taste and adjust the amount of praline paste to your preference.
Step 3
Coarsely crumble 2 speculoos cookies into the bottom of each mug or glass. Pour the hot drink over them. The cookies will soften slightly while keeping some crunch, adding an irresistible texture to every sip.
Step 4
Top each drink with a generous dollop of whipped cream. Crumble the remaining 2 speculoos cookies over the cream. For an extra praline touch, sprinkle with a few caramelized hazelnut pieces or a drizzle of caramel sauce. Serve immediately and enjoy while hot.
💡 Tips & variations
- Use quality praline paste for an authentic caramelized hazelnut flavor.
- For an even more indulgent version, add a spoonful of Nutella or hazelnut spread.
- Serve hot in winter or warm in summer, with ice cubes for an iced version.
